If your boosting for the rest of the achievements, this will probably just come with time. This can be done in Ranked matches with only 2 people, even in Team modes. A big factor in this is also the level of anyone you kill, the higher the level they are from you nets you better experience.
The better you do in match the more Exp. you get: the more medals you earn the more Exp. So as you are boosting just score a lot of head shots, kills streaks (5 in a row is max) Survive w/out dying and multiple kills with different weapons all earn medals which equal experience.
I have played matches at various lengths between 10-30 min each. (non split) I get about 4-5 medals a match, these are the best examples as I remember>
Survivor (for not dying for the whole match) , kills streak (kill 5 enemies in a row without dying), rifle expert (Kill 3 or 5 enemies with the rifle), headshots Kill 3 or 5 enemies with headshots) and depending on the length of the match. 10 min. 3/4 of a level 15 min 1 level + 20 min 1 1/2 levels 30 min 1 3/4 + (almost 2 levels)
The higher you get in level, the more experience you need to go up in level. Around level 90 for example you will need approximately 10k in experience to go up a single level.
Playing/boosting against a level 20 or higher Point Snatcher Match, 10 kills net you approximately 3400 in experience.
That's it it really just depends on how aggressive you want to be at boosting. The thing is you'll reach level 100 way before you get you 200 wins, 500 matches played and 5000 player kills. Just remember it has to be Ranked and though there are not alot of randoms/other players there does seem to be significant online presents for this game.
